On Monday, three migrants died and at least 25 more are missing after their boat sank off the Greek island of Samos. The Greek coastguard has rescued five migrants and is continuing a search and rescue operation. This incident occurred in the northwestern part of the island, and Greece has historically been a popular entry point for migrants and refugees from various regions, including the Middle East, Africa, and Asia.
